Bitcoin ATM Near Me Canada: Locations & Fees Explained

Finding a BTC machine in you can feel like a challenge, but it's increasingly easier! This article details how to find digital currency ATMs across Canada and what fees to anticipate. You can use online maps like CoinATMRadar or platforms like Bitcoin.ca to search available machines. Keep in mind Bitcoin machine charges are generally higher than buying digital currency from an exchange, typically ranging 7% to 15% or even greater! Certain kiosks may also have daily limits on the value of digital currency you can purchase. Here’s a quick look at what to consider:

The Canadian Bitcoin ATM Environment: Trends & Reach

The local Bitcoin ATM market is seeing ongoing development, although its rate remains somewhat moderate compared to regions like the United States. Currently, approximately between 150 and 200 machines are working across the nation, primarily located in major urban centers such as Toronto, Vancouver, and Calgary. Reach is still a significant challenge, particularly in rural regions, where setting up and supporting these kiosks can be costly. Several firms are participating in installing these ATMs, and patterns indicate a change towards cheaper purchase fees, alongside greater emphasis on user experience. Investing in Bitcoin Canada: Buying & Selling with ATMs

For Canadians looking for a quick way to participate in the Bitcoin world, Bitcoin ATMs offer a alternative method. While fees are generally higher than online exchanges, these machines provide a accessible method for purchasing Bitcoin using cash or, in certain cases, selling Bitcoin for Canadian dollars. It’s vital to investigate the individual Bitcoin ATM's machine and its exchange limits before making a buy or sale. Remember to carefully evaluate rates and be aware of the linked risks.
